History and Growth:
Internet poker emerged when you look at the late 1990s due to developments in technology and also the net. The very first internet poker space, globe Poker, was launched in 1998, attracting a small but enthusiastic neighborhood. But was at early 2000s that on-line poker experienced exponential development, primarily due to the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

One of the main good reasons for the enormous popularity of online poker is its availability. Players can log in to a common internet poker platforms whenever you want, from everywhere, employing their computers or cellular devices. This convenience has actually attracted a varied player base, including recreational people to specialists, leading to the fast growth of on-line poker.
Advantages of Internet Poker:
Online poker provides several benefits over conventional brick-and-mortar casinos. Firstly, it gives a broader number of online game choices, including different poker alternatives and stakes, providing toward tastes and hightstakes budgets of most kinds of people. Additionally, online poker areas are open 24/7, eliminating the limitations of real casino working hours. Also, on line systems usually offer attractive incentives, commitment programs, and also the power to play numerous tables simultaneously, improving the general gaming experience.
